Bob Goodwin wrote:
> Sharpe, Sam J wrote:
>> Bob Goodwin wrote:
>>>
>>> Can someone tell me how I can arrange to be able to run
>>> system-control-network as user bobg. It looks like I should
>>> be able to accomplish this via visudo but that is overwhelmingly
>>> complex.
>>>
>>> My objective is to be able to close or open my eth0 internet connection
>>> without
>>> jumping though hoops. As it stands I have to use system-config-network,
>>> enter password, and when the GUI comes up I can then click on
>>> "de/activate."
Hi, If you want to use sudo the following should work for you
visudo and add
bobg ALL = NOPASSWD: /usr/bin/system-config-network
then sudo system-config-network
